Marine invertebrates commonly have a biphasic life cycle in which the metamorphic transition from a pelagic larva to a benthic post-larva is mediated by the nitric oxide signalling pathway. Nitric oxide (NO) is synthesised by nitric oxide synthase (NOS), which is a client protein of the molecular chaperon heat shock protein 90 (HSP90). This is a study of the English writing of metamorphosis from the Reformation to the late seventeenth century. It asks what work is done by the imagining of transformation in this period and explores events and creatures which may seem to us fantastic: animated stones, werewolves, wild children.
